Spend The Afternoon Visiting Some Of Cairo 'S Most Famous And Ancient Churches: The Hanging Church, Built At The End Of The 3rd Century. When St. Mark Came To Egypt Around Year 50 Or 60 A.D., Christianity Was Introduced To Egypt And The Coptic (Egyptian) Church Started To Grow. In Cairo This Happened First Of All Around The Area Of Babylon - And This Is What Today Often Is Called "Old Cairo" And Where One Finds Most Of The Ancient Churches In Egypt . The Most Famous Is The Church Of The Holy Virgin Mary (El Mo'allaqa, Or The " Hanging Church - As It's Built On And Between Two Of The Old Towers Of The Babylon Fortress). It Is The Oldest Church In Cairo . Then You Will Go On To Visit The Church Of St. Sergius , Built In The 4th Century. The Abu Sarga Church Is Also Called The Church Of Saint Sergius And Bacchus. The Church Of Abu Sarga Is Built Over The Crypt Where The Holy Family Is Believed To Have Taken Refuge During Their Flight Into Egypt . You Will Continue On To Visit St. Barbara Church, Built Sometime In The 4th Century.
